Business Studies Class 12 Chapter 1 MCQ
What is the definition of management according to Harold Koontz and Heinz Weihrich?
- Achieving personal objectives
- Coordinating individual effort
- Efficiently using limited resources
- Organizing organizational operations
Correct Answer: b) Coordinating individual effort
Management is concerned with achieving goals _______ and _______.
- quickly, effectively
- effectively, efficiently
- efficiently, quickly
- equally, effectively
Correct Answer: b) effectively, efficiently
What is the term for the process of guiding efforts towards achieving common objectives?
- Leadership
- Direction
- Management
- Coordination
Correct Answer: c) Management
Which dimension of management involves solving problems, making decisions, and establishing plans?
- Management of work
- Management of people
- Management of operations
- Management of resources
Correct Answer: a) Management of work
Which dimension of management involves dealing with employees as individuals and as a group?
- Management of work
- Management of people
- Management of operations
- Management of resources
Correct Answer: b) Management of people
What is the main characteristic of a dynamic function of management?
- Constant change and adaptation
- Linear progression
- Static and unchanging approach
- Predictable outcomes
Correct Answer: a) Constant change and adaptation
Management can be considered an art because it involves:
- Rigid application of rules
- Repetition of tasks
- Creative application of knowledge
- Universal principles
Correct Answer: c) Creative application of knowledge
Science is characterized by principles that are based on:
- Observation and repetition
- Experimentation and flexibility
- Creativity and personal interpretation
- Cause and effect relationships
Correct Answer: d) Cause and effect relationships
Which level of management is responsible for implementing and controlling plans formulated by top management?
- Top management
- Middle management
- Supervisory management
- Operational management
Correct Answer: b) Middle management
The role of top management includes:
- Overseeing daily operations
- Implementing middle management plans
- Developing overall organizational goals
- Directly supervising frontline workers
Correct Answer: c) Developing overall organizational goals
Middle management acts as a link between:
- Top and middle management
- Middle and lower management
- Top and lower management
- Operational and strategic management
Correct Answer: c) Top and lower management
What is the key responsibility of supervisors in the management hierarchy?
- Developing organizational goals
- Creating strategic plans
- Overseeing top management activities
- Directly overseeing the workforce
Correct Answer: d) Directly overseeing the workforce
Management is concerned with achieving goals efficiently and:
- Quickly
- Individually
- Effectively
- Permanently
Correct Answer: c) Effectively
Which dimension of management involves translating goals into actionable plans?
- Management of work
- Management of people
- Management of operations
- Management of resources
Correct Answer: a) Management of work
What is the primary motive of a profession?
- Personal gain
- Competitive advantage
- Ethical conduct
- Service to clients
Correct Answer: d) Service to clients
Which level of management is responsible for integrating diverse elements and coordinating activities of different departments?
- Top management
- Middle management
- Supervisory management
- Operational management
Correct Answer: a) Top management
Management is both an art and a science because:
- It involves creative application of principles
- It is based on experimentation and observation
- It relies solely on standardized techniques
- It focuses only on practical skills
Correct Answer: a) It involves creative application of principles
Middle management is responsible for:
- Developing organizational goals
- Directly overseeing frontline workers
- Implementing and controlling plans
- Analyzing the external environment
Correct Answer: c) Implementing and controlling plans
Which dimension of management deals with the flow of input material and the transformation process?
- Management of work
- Management of people
- Management of operations
- Management of resources
Correct Answer: c) Management of operations
What distinguishes a successful manager from a less successful one?
- Number of years in the industry
- Knowledge of theoretical principles
- Memorization of management definitions
- Application of principles in practice
Correct Answer: d) Application of principles in practice
